Top Platforms and Their Sweet Spots

Netflix still leads with international hits and original series, but it’s not the only player. Amazon Prime Video offers a mix of Hollywood blockbusters and strong regional content, especially in Hindi, Tamil, and Telugu. Disney+ Hotstar is the sports king – live cricket, football, and the latest Disney classics are all in one place.

For those who love Bollywood and Indian TV, Zee5 and SonyLIV bring a lot of local shows, reality series, and exclusive movies. If you’re on a tight budget, Voot and MX Player let you stream many titles for free with ads. Each platform has its own strengths, so the best choice depends on what you watch most.

How to Save Money While Streaming

Subscriptions add up fast. A simple trick is to rotate platforms every few months. Cancel a service when you’ve finished its exclusive series, then re‑activate later if a new show catches your eye. Many providers also offer bundled deals – for example, Disney+ Hotstar often teams up with telecom operators for discounted rates.

Don’t forget trial periods. Most services give a 7‑ to 30‑day free window. Use that time to test the app’s UI, streaming quality, and content library before committing. If you share a family plan, you can cover several users under one account, cutting costs further.

Another cost‑saving tip is to watch in lower resolution when you’re on a limited data plan. Most apps let you switch between HD, SD, and even data‑saving modes. You’ll still enjoy your shows, but your data bill will stay in check.

Finally, keep an eye on promo codes during festivals and big sales. Platforms launch special discounts around Diwali, New Year, and cricket tournaments. A quick search can land you 20‑30% off the regular price.
